Our Wholesale Cardboard Sheet Product Line

Knowing what's actually available helps you spec correctly rather than settling for whatever happens to be in stock. Our production lines in Cleveland, Ohio and Los Angeles, California run three primary single-wall corrugated profiles, each suited to different applications.

E-flute corrugated sheets deliver approximately 90 flutes per linear foot with a caliper around 1/16 inch (0.0625 inches). This profile works beautifully for retail packaging where surface smoothness matters for branded packaging applications. I recommend E-flute to clients creating subscription boxes and premium unboxing experiences—the fine flute structure accepts high-quality printing and provides decent crush resistance for products under 10 pounds.

B-flute sheets pack 47 flutes per linear foot with 1/8-inch caliper (0.125 inches). The workhorse profile for most wholesale cardboard sheets for packaging applications. The balance between compression strength and surface area makes B-flute ideal for shipping boxes, mailers, and general-purpose protective packaging. Most standard stock sizes run B-flute. C-flute sits in the middle at 39 flutes per linear foot with approximately 3/32-inch caliper (0.09375 inches). This profile handles heavier products and stacking situations better than B-flute while maintaining reasonable surface quality for printing. Shipping dense items like canned goods, hardware, or ceramics? C-flute deserves consideration.

Double-wall corrugated sheets combine two corrugated mediums with three liner facings, delivering substantially higher compression strength for industrial applications. We produce double-wall in 48 and 64 ECT ratings depending on stacking and transit requirements.

Kraft corrugated cardboard sheets form the backbone of utility and industrial product packaging. The natural brown appearance communicates authenticity for many brands, and kraft fiber provides excellent printability for shipping labels and basic graphics. We stock kraft in test ratings from 32 lb through 200 lb to match specific application requirements.

White-top sheets laminate white clay-coated newsback to corrugated medium, producing a smooth printing surface ideal for custom printed boxes and consumer-facing branded packaging. Technical Specifications and Material Grades

Material specifications can feel overwhelming if you're new to packaging design, but they boil down to three performance characteristics that actually affect your application: compression resistance, burst strength, and caliper thickness. Numbers that matter:

ECT, or Edge Crush Test, measures the force required to crush the corrugated medium when edge-loaded measured in pounds per inch (lb/in). Higher ECT numbers indicate greater stacking compression strength. Our standard offerings range from 32 ECT through 65 ECT:

  • 32 ECT: Appropriate for light products under 20 lbs, temporary shelving, one-way shippers. Most retail-available sheets fall here.
  • 44 ECT: The sweet spot for most e-commerce and retail packaging applications. Handles stacking heights to 48 inches reliably.
  • 55 ECT: Heavy-duty applications, dense products over 40 lbs, multiple-layer stacking configurations.
  • 65 ECT: Industrial strength, heavy components over 80 lbs, export packaging subject to compression during container loading.

Burst strength, measured in pounds per square inch (PSI), indicates resistance to puncture and tearing. Burst ratings matter more for packaging that undergoes rough handling or contains products with sharp edges. Standard ranges from 125 PSI for light-duty applications to 350 PSI for heavy industrial use.

Caliber and thickness determine how sheets handle during conversion and how much cushioning they provide. Thickness affects your folding equipment settings and your package's rigidity. The 1/16 inch through 1/4 inch range covers everything from delicate consumer goods to industrial components.

Recycled content percentages have become increasingly important for package branding and corporate sustainability commitments. We offer four grades:

  • 30% recycled content: Entry-level sustainable option at minimal 3% cost premium
  • 50% recycled content: Common choice for companies with moderate sustainability goals
  • 70% recycled content: Strong environmental positioning without significant cost increase of 6%
  • 100% recycled content: Maximum sustainability for brands prioritizing environmental messaging at 12% premium

Supply chains requiring Forest Stewardship Council certification—common in European markets and increasingly requested by US retailers—can access FSC-certified virgin fiber options. The FSC certification chain of custody documentation verifies responsible forestry practices.

A word of caution: recycled content percentages can be misleading without understanding fiber sources and processing. Higher recycled content doesn't always mean lower quality, but it can mean more color variation between batches. If absolute color consistency matters for your brand, factor that into your specification decisions.
